Walt Disney (1901–1966), American entrepreneur, animator & film producer, co-founded The Walt Disney Company & built a legacy on imagination at scale. He created Mickey Mouse, pioneered modern animation & theme parks, & transformed global family entertainment. But for Disney, entrepreneurship wasn’t just creative vision — it was the relentless pursuit of capital to make that vision real. Funding was often the hardest part of the dream. Today’s beloved empire was built on years of financial risk most people never saw.
Every animated classic & theme park was backed by an entrepreneur who fought for the resources to make the impossible tangible.
This message is summarized by his quote, “I’d say it’s been my biggest problem all…it’s money. It takes a lot of money to make these dreams come true.”
